Output 3c831e4e17d5776828820a8ee17a9f2854707c6ab7c47c39063f154ed20e6e41:1

value
42143176
script pubkey
OP_0 OP_PUSHBYTES_20 6bac95bbedd18ea18bec0cb37197bf93a4bc67ad
address
ltc1qdwkftwld6x82rzlvpjehr9aljwjtceadp8nrn9
transaction
3c831e4e17d5776828820a8ee17a9f2854707c6ab7c47c39063f154ed20e6e41
spent
true